Concrete bomb

Concrete bomb
German WWII bombs: explosive to left, rest concrete practice bombs (250 kg and 50 kg)

A concrete bomb is an aerial bomb which contains dense, inert material (typically concrete) instead of explosive. The target is destroyed using the kinetic energy of the falling bomb. Such weapons can only practically be deployed when configured as a laser-guided bomb or other form of smart bomb, as a direct hit on a small target is required to cause significant damage. They are typically used to destroy military vehicles and artillery pieces in urban areas, in order to minimise collateral damage and civilian casualties.[1]

Guided or unguided concrete bombs may also be used for training pilots and ground personnel, due to the advantages of cost (no explosives or fusing), point of impact determination, minimised bombing range damage and safety. Concrete bombs are also used in testing and evaluation of aircraft and bombs.
